Description

Lock cylinder capable of preventing violent unlocking
Technical Field
The application relates to the field of lock cylinders, in particular to a lock cylinder capable of preventing violent unlocking.
Background
The lock core is an important component of the door lock and plays a great role in daily life of people.
The invention patent with the granted publication number of CN106522666A provides a breakage-proof lock core, wherein a platform is cut on the upper part of an internal rotation key, and a lower magnetic attraction piece is fixedly arranged in the platform; an upper magnetic attraction piece is arranged in an upper magnetic attraction piece sliding groove of the inner lock liner above the lower magnetic attraction piece, and the upper magnetic attraction piece and the lower magnetic attraction piece are attracted with each other; in a normal state, the bottom of the upper magnetic part is tangent to the excircle of the inner rotating key, and the height of the upper magnetic part is higher than the depth of the platform; when the lock core is broken off at the position of the limiting groove, the spring pushes the inward rotating key outwards, and the upper magnetic part is attracted by the magnetic part under the action of magnetic force and falls onto the platform.

Detailed Description
The present application is described in further detail below with reference to figures 1-9.
The embodiment of the application discloses lock core that anti-riot power unblanked. Referring to fig. 2, the lock case comprises a lock case 1, a dial 2 arranged in an open slot in the middle of the lock case 1, an inner lock liner 3 and an outer lock liner 4 arranged in the lock case 1, wherein the inner lock liner 3 and the outer lock liner 4 are respectively positioned at two sides of the dial 2, the lock case 1 is provided with a first breaking slot 6 serving as an external force damage breaking position at one side corresponding to the outer lock liner 4, and a lock sleeve 5 (see fig. 1) surrounding the outer lock liner 4 and the inner lock liner 3 is arranged outside the lock case 1.
Referring to fig. 1, the lock sleeve 5 is composed of a first lock sleeve 8 and a second lock sleeve 9, the first lock sleeve 8 is close to the poking and picking device 2, the second lock sleeve 9 is far away from the poking and picking device 2, and the position where the first lock sleeve 8 is connected with the second lock sleeve 9 is consistent with the position of the first breaking groove 6 on the lock shell 1.
Referring to fig. 3, to facilitate removal and installation of the first and second sleeves 8, 9, the first sleeve 8 has a slot 27 facing the second sleeve 9, the second sleeve 9 has a third insert 25 engaging the slot 27, and the slot 27 and the third insert 25 are located at opposite ends of the first and second sleeves 8, 9, respectively.
Referring to fig. 6, a through groove 7 along the axial direction of the first lock sleeve 8 is formed in the first lock sleeve 8, the through groove 7 is communicated with the poking and picking part 2, and a limiting groove 10 along the axial direction of the first lock sleeve 8 is formed in the through groove 7. The limiting groove 10 is internally provided with a telescopic column 11 which is perpendicular to the axial direction of the first lock sleeve 8, and the telescopic column 11 can only slide along the axial direction of the first lock sleeve 8 in the limiting groove 10.
Referring to fig. 6, the telescopic column 11 is composed of a first cylinder 20 and a second cylinder 21 both having a hollow inside, the first cylinder 20 and the second cylinder 21 both having a hollow cylinder, and a second spring 14 is coaxially connected between the first cylinder 20 and the second cylinder 21. The second spring 14 is located in the cavity of the first cylinder 20 and the second cylinder 21, one end of the second spring 14 is connected with the inner wall of the first cylinder 20, the other end of the second spring 14 is connected with the inner wall of the second cylinder 21, and the second cylinder 21 is inserted into the first cylinder 20 in a sliding manner along the self-axial direction.
Referring to fig. 6, a first spring 12 is connected between the outer side wall of the first cylinder 20 and the side wall of the limiting groove 10 far away from the dial 2, and the first spring 12 is axially arranged along the first lock sleeve 8. The first spring 12 is provided with a guide post 28 coaxial with the first spring 12, one end of the guide post 28 far away from the telescopic post 11 is fixedly connected on the inner wall of the limiting groove 10, and the other end of the guide post 28 is suspended.
Referring to fig. 8, the two opposite side surfaces of the limiting groove 10 along the width direction thereof are respectively provided with a sliding groove 23, the sliding grooves 23 are arranged along the length direction of the limiting groove 10, the first column body 20 is provided with a second plug-in unit 24 matched with the sliding grooves 23, the second plug-in unit 24 is inserted into the sliding grooves 23, and the second plug-in unit 24 can slide in the sliding grooves 23 along the length direction of the limiting groove 10.
Referring to fig. 6, a straight rod 13 parallel to the axial direction of the first lock sleeve 8 is fixed on the second column 21, the straight rod 13 extends to the end part of the poking and picking part 2 to fix a fixture block 15, and the fixture block 15 can abut against the inner wall of the through groove 7 to slide along the axial direction parallel to the first lock sleeve 8. The straight rod 13 is connected with a fixing rod 18, and the fixing rod 18 penetrates through the first lock sleeve 8 and is connected with the second lock sleeve 9.
Referring to fig. 9, the end of the fixing rod 18 has a first plug-in unit 19, and the side of the straight rod 13 is provided with a second slot 17 for the first plug-in unit 19 to be inserted. When the first plug-in piece 19 is inserted into the second slot 17, the straight rod 13 can be pulled due to the limited length of the fixing rod 18, and the first spring 12 is in a compressed state, so that the first spring 12 is prevented from extending to enable the clamping block 15 to extend out of the through slot 7. The fixing lever 18 has a second breaking groove 26 for easily breaking the fixing lever 18.
Referring to fig. 1, the poking arm 2 is provided with a clamping groove 16 for inserting the clamping block 15, when a lawless person breaks the lock cylinder, the first lock sleeve 8 and the second lock sleeve 9 are separated, the fixing rod 18 is also disconnected, the fixing rod 18 can not exert pulling force any more at the moment, and the first spring 12 is recovered from a compression state, so that the clamping block 15 extends out of the through groove 7 and is inserted into the clamping groove 16.
Referring to fig. 1, in order to insert the latch 15 into the latch groove 16 more firmly, a magnetic attraction member 22 for attracting the latch 15 is fixed in the latch groove 16.
The implementation principle of a lock core that anti-riot power unblanked in this application embodiment is: the first plug-in unit 19 at the end of the fixing rod 18 is inserted into the second clamping groove 17 of the straight rod 13, and because the length of the fixing rod 18 is limited, the fixing rod 18 can pull the straight rod 13, so that the first spring 12 is compressed, and the clamping block 15 on the straight rod 13 is limited in the through groove 7; the latch 15 is abutted by the inner wall of the first lock case 8, thereby compressing the second spring 14. When a lawbreaker breaks the lock core through violence, the lock core is broken from the first breaking groove 6, meanwhile, the lock sleeve 5 is also broken and is separated from the connection part of the first lock sleeve 8 and the second lock sleeve 9, at the moment, the fixed rod 18 is broken from the second breaking groove 26, the fixed rod 18 does not apply pulling force on the straight rod 13 any more, at the moment, the first spring 12 is recovered from a compressed state, and the telescopic column 11 slides to the poking part 2 in the limit groove 10; after the clamping block 15 extends out of the first lock sleeve 8, the second spring 14 extends the telescopic column 11, so that the clamping block 15 is inserted into the clamping groove 16 on the poking and picking device 2, and a lawbreaker cannot poke and pick the device 2 to open the door by rotating from the outside after breaking the lock cylinder.
